WENATCHEE, Aug. 24—Wenatchee was back within striking distance of the third place Spokane Indians tonight after taking their second win in three starts against the Western International league leading Yakima Bears. The Chiefs walloped the Yankees 10-3 Wednesday.
Wenatchee was never in trouble after collecting four runs against Yakima in the first inning. Merle Frick, Chief pitcher, gave up but five hits.
Salem didn't move out in front of Spokane until the seventh inning when seven runs crossed the plate, climaxed by a three-run homer off the bat of Art Pennington, flashy negro shortstop.

SPOKANE, Aug. 24—Spokane bowed to Salem 11-9 in a Wednesday night WIL contest. The decision gave the Oregonians the three game series 2-1.
